Teaching Tech: Technology Help for Seniors

by Susan Davis

The Seniors Ministry is excited to partner with our neighbor, St. John’s School, to bring you Teaching Tech—a monthly technology class designed to help seniors grow more confident with today’s tools. During each session, attendees are paired with St. John’s School students who offer one-on-one and small-group assistance. Whether you’re just getting started or need help troubleshooting, our student partners are ready to guide you step by step.

One of the best parts? Teaching Tech provides personalized flashcards and learning resources after each lesson, so you can keep practicing at home.

Not sure if this class is for you? Here are some of the real questions past attendees have asked:

  • Could you help me set up an email account?
  • I know I have an email account, but I’m not sure how to filter through my messages.
  • How do I navigate Google Maps?
  • I just got a new computer—how do I transfer my data?
  • I want to start an Instagram account. How do I use the app?
  • Could you help me set up my new computer?
  • I’m having trouble organizing my passwords.

We’ve also assisted with tasks like sorting through flash drives, making Instagram posts and reels, and cleaning out storage on devices.

Whether it’s sending your first email, finding directions online, or simply getting comfortable with your smartphone, Teaching Tech is here to help. Drop in during our next session and see how fun learning technology can be!

Teaching Tech meets on Fourth Wednesdays, 4 pm - 5:15 pm in the Parlor
